climateprediction.net home page
Windows Sockets Interface Error on BOINC 4.13

Windows Sockets Interface Error on BOINC 4.13

Questions and Answers : Windows : Windows Sockets Interface Error on BOINC 4.13
Message board moderation

To post messages, you must log in.

AuthorMessage
Profile old_user4247

Send message
Joined: 31 Aug 04
Posts: 8
Credit: 66,295
RAC: 0
Message 5353 - Posted: 14 Oct 2004, 11:11:28 UTC

I\'ve just upgraded to BOINC 4.13.

Now everytime I start BOINC, I get an error message.

Failed to cleanup the Windows Sockets Interface

But other than this error message, everything looks fine.

Is there any solution to stop this error message?
ID: 5353 · Report as offensive     Reply Quote
Profile geophi
Volunteer moderator

Send message
Joined: 7 Aug 04
Posts: 2167
Credit: 64,488,748
RAC: 4,577
Message 5357 - Posted: 14 Oct 2004, 12:54:58 UTC

This typically means that two instances of BOINC are running at the same time. Is it starting as a service and from the startup folder or icon? Is it in the startup folder under more than one user? There have been several reports of this problem. Do a search for sockets on this forum and you should find help.
ID: 5357 · Report as offensive     Reply Quote
Profile astroWX
Volunteer moderator

Send message
Joined: 5 Aug 04
Posts: 1496
Credit: 95,522,203
RAC: 0
Message 5368 - Posted: 14 Oct 2004, 19:29:35 UTC
Last modified: 14 Oct 2004, 19:38:22 UTC

Hi, George,

I received this message, too, earlier today, on my only Windoze machine. Some unknown thing happened to Cbox (XP SP1, P4 HT 3.0).

I was making my morning rounds of machines and got nothing from Cbox. Screen changed from black to dark gray, otherwise, there was no response to keyboard or mouse. (One screen supports all four machines via KVM switch.)

I tried all I could think of to get its attention but nothing worked so, reluctantly, I hit 'power off'.

After re-booting, I checked the client_state.xml file and it SEEMED okay (though I'm not experienced enough to note minor discrepancies), so I gulped and cranked up boinc GUI. (Manual start only; not a Service and nothing for boinc in Start file.)

There was a pop-up window from boinc with "Failed to cleanup the Windows Sockets Interface". Apparently, it recovered okay, same as for arata.

I dodged a bullet after hitting 'power off' -- this time.

Trickles for the two models were sent 37 & 38 minutes later. (The lock-up, based upon Trickle times, lasted 10+ hours. Is this, perhaps, XP's version of a BSOD?)

P.S. Congratulations on selection as User of the Week.


We have met the enemy and he is us -- Pogo
ID: 5368 · Report as offensive     Reply Quote
Profile old_user4247

Send message
Joined: 31 Aug 04
Posts: 8
Credit: 66,295
RAC: 0
Message 5376 - Posted: 14 Oct 2004, 23:19:43 UTC - in response to Message 5357.  

Hi, geophi,

> This typically means that two instances of BOINC are running at the same time.
> Is it starting as a service and from the startup folder or icon? Is it in
> the startup folder under more than one user? There have been several reports
> of this problem. Do a search for sockets on this forum and you should
> find help.

Thanks for your advise.

I checked my PC and there were 2 BOINC startups (one for mine and another for every-user).
I don't know why this happened.
Also my screensaver was set to BOINC. (I didn't set BOINC as a screensaver)

Maybe, install program of BOINC 4.13 does something different from previous version.
ID: 5376 · Report as offensive     Reply Quote
Profile Thyme Lawn
Volunteer moderator

Send message
Joined: 5 Aug 04
Posts: 1283
Credit: 15,824,334
RAC: 0
Message 5386 - Posted: 15 Oct 2004, 7:08:50 UTC - in response to Message 5376.  
Last modified: 15 Oct 2004, 7:10:31 UTC

> I checked my PC and there were 2 BOINC startups (one for mine and another for every-user).

Hi arata,

Having 2 startups is the reason you're getting this problem, but it's not an error that impacts on model processing. I identified a fix and notified the solution to the BOINC developer mailing list on 4th Oct. It was supposed to have been fixed the same day, but I've just spotted in the source archive for last night that it hasn't been. I'll raise it with the powers that be.

As to why you have 2 startups and the BOINC screensaver go installed, I'd guess it's something to do with the installation program.

Anyone not interested in the technical explanation for the sockets error can ignore the following :)

It's down to the way that BOINC is checking that only a single instance is run. When the second boinc_gui program starts up it detects that there is another BOINC program running (it doesn't matter if it's boinc_gui or boinc_cli), so it terminates itself. The exit routine always cleans up the windows socket interface. But in this case the interface had never been initialised, so you get the error box.
<br><a href="http://www.teampicard.net"><img src="http://www.teampicard.net/templates/fisubice/images/phpbb2_logo.jpg"></a><a href="http://climateapps2.oucs.ox.ac.uk/cpdnboinc/team_display.php?teamid=3">Join us here</a>
ID: 5386 · Report as offensive     Reply Quote
Profile old_user4247

Send message
Joined: 31 Aug 04
Posts: 8
Credit: 66,295
RAC: 0
Message 5404 - Posted: 15 Oct 2004, 13:21:09 UTC - in response to Message 5386.  

Hi Thyme,

Thanks for your message.
I did delete one startup BOINC so it's fine now.

Let's see if this problem will be fixed in the next new version or not.
ID: 5404 · Report as offensive     Reply Quote
Profile Brian Uitti

Send message
Joined: 28 Aug 04
Posts: 13
Credit: 242,108
RAC: 0
Message 5425 - Posted: 16 Oct 2004, 14:42:29 UTC - in response to Message 5357.  

&gt; This typically means that two instances of BOINC are running at the same time.

YES, THANKS FOR THE ANSWER. I had posted this question on the SETI Message boards, and have yet to receive a reply.. Here's my further explanation:


During the installation of the V4.13 Client, I had the installer add the icon the startup folder.

On Windows 2000, you have two startup folders..

1. one for all users,
Example: C:\Documents and Settings\All Users\Start Menu

2. the other for individual user(s):
Example: C:\Documents and Settings\LOGGED_IN_USER\Start Menu

Since I had a BOINC Client icon in my user startup and the installer put one in the all users startup .. It resulted in TWO BOINC CLIENTS running in startup .. the second Client starup reports the error, and terminates.

// Brian

ID: 5425 · Report as offensive     Reply Quote
Profile Andrew Hingston
Volunteer moderator

Send message
Joined: 17 Aug 04
Posts: 753
Credit: 9,804,700
RAC: 0
Message 5429 - Posted: 16 Oct 2004, 16:35:24 UTC

When I upgraded to 4.13, I found that it simply installed a second instance in my own startup folder.

You'd think it would at least be consistent. :)
ID: 5429 · Report as offensive     Reply Quote

Questions and Answers : Windows : Windows Sockets Interface Error on BOINC 4.13

©2024 climateprediction.net